Meaning

dust
Extended definition

Fine particles of earth or soil, often associated with symbolic rejection or mourning in biblical contexts.

1earth, soil.
2In later writers (Pint., LXX), = κονιορτός, dust: Mrk.6:11, Rev.18:19.
Source: STEPBible TBESG + Abbott-Smith
